This is a favorite venue which we often visit and have enjoyed seating in numerous locations. Congrats on planning to attend this often missed experience which typically is filled with locals.
Keep in mind the music is only a part of the experience as the architecture truly allows the word "unique" to be applied. The acoustics within the facility are great and it is also an air conditioned experience! My guidance would be to sit in the middle of the balcony so you can absorb the full experience. This will allow the widest perspective for viewing the building, watching the people, good visibility to the stage and ample listening opportunity. We suggest you dress for the occasion (long pants, nice shirt, do not really need a coat, but I often wear one; a dress or nice skirt and blouse for women). We take photos after the concert. One concert was half full so we moved seats without any comment from the ushers.
We also encourage you to take a tour of the place prior to attending the concert. There is an informative video on the history and a guided tour. Recall the place is air conditioned so we encourage folks to schedule it into an afternoon as an escape from the heat. There is a tapas bar, but it is pretty dog gone expensive. Enjoy!
